
Ryu Ga Gotoku Studio unveiled Yakuza Kiwami 3 last week at their recent Summit – a reveal many anticipated, as the game briefly showed up on their website beforehand. They also announced Dark Ties, a side story in the style of a Gaiden title, focusing on Yoshitaka Mine, the villain from Yakuza 3.
In addition to new missions and areas to explore, the side story centers on Mine becoming involved with the criminal world. Originally, it wasn’t intended to be a playable experience. Director Ryosuke Horii explained to Famitsu (translated by Automaton Media) that Dark Ties was envisioned as “more of a cinematic experience, like watching a video.”
The team opted for a playable character, believing it was “the best way to tell his story.” Series producer Hiroyuki Sakamoto also mentioned that Mine is consistently ranked among the top five most popular characters with fans. If there was ever a perfect moment to make him playable, it was definitely Dark Ties.
Horii points out that Mine’s story is “cooler and more stylish” than that of Yakuza 3. He explains, “With Dark Ties, Mine begins as a businessman, and we show him getting more and more caught up in the yakuza world – something we haven’t done before. Unlike Kiryu and other characters, Mine isn’t driven by a strong sense of justice. Even in the side stories, he doesn’t help people by fighting against injustice or protecting those in need.”
We’ll find out how things go when Yakuza Kiwami 3 and Dark Ties become available on February 12th, 2026, for PS4, PS5, Xbox Series X/S, PC, and Nintendo Switch 2. It will be released as a combined package. You can see some of the fighting action from the first game here, showcasing the updated Dragon of Dojima Style.
